Growth Dynamics: Drivers, Challenges, and Industry Catalysts Macroeconomic and Industry-Specific Drivers Digital Economy Acceleration: South Korea’s robust digital infrastructure, high internet penetration (~96%), and government initiatives like the Digital New Deal bolster demand for high-speed storage solutions. Data Center Expansion: Major players such as Naver, Kakao, and global hyperscalers are investing heavily in local data centers, increasing NVMe adoption for low-latency, high-throughput storage. Technological Advancements: Innovations in 3D NAND, PCIe 4.0/5.0, and emerging PCIe 6.0 standards enhance NVMe performance, making them more attractive for enterprise and consumer segments. Emerging AI & Big Data Applications: Growing AI workloads, machine learning, and real-time analytics demand high-performance NVMe storage, fueling market growth. Challenges and Risks Supply Chain Constraints: Semiconductor shortages and geopolitical tensions may impact raw material sourcing and manufacturing timelines. Regulatory & Cybersecurity Risks: Data privacy laws and cybersecurity threats pose compliance and operational challenges. Price Volatility: Fluctuations in NAND flash memory prices can impact profit margins and pricing strategies. Market Ecosystem and Operational Framework Key Product Categories Client NVMe SSDs: Primarily used in consumer laptops, ultrabooks, and gaming devices. Enterprise NVMe SSDs: Deployed in data centers, cloud infrastructure, and enterprise storage arrays. Embedded NVMe Modules: Integrated into IoT devices, automotive systems, and edge computing platforms. Stakeholders and Demand-Supply Framework Manufacturers & ODMs: Samsung Electronics, SK Hynix, and local ODMs design and produce NVMe modules. Distributors & Retailers: Electronic retail chains, online marketplaces, and B2B distributors facilitate product reach. End-Users: Data centers, cloud service providers, OEMs, enterprise IT firms, and consumers. Supply Chain & Revenue Models The value chain begins with raw material sourcing (silicon wafers, NAND flash chips), followed by fabrication, assembly, and testing. Distribution channels include direct OEM sales, third-party distributors, and retail outlets. Revenue streams are derived from product sales, maintenance, lifecycle services, and licensing of proprietary technologies. Technological & System Integration Trends Digital transformation initiatives are pushing NVMe adoption through system integration with hyper-converged infrastructure (HCI), software-defined storage (SDS), and cloud-native architectures. Interoperability standards such as NVMe over Fabrics (NVMe-oF) are enabling seamless, high-speed data transfer across heterogeneous environments. Collaborations between hardware vendors and software providers are fostering ecosystem interoperability, reducing latency, and enhancing scalability. The integration of NVMe with emerging AI accelerators and edge computing devices is opening new application niches. Adoption Trends & End-User Insights In South Korea, enterprise adoption of NVMe is accelerating, driven by cloud migration and AI workloads. Consumer adoption remains robust, especially in high-performance gaming and ultrabooks. The automotive sector is exploring NVMe for autonomous vehicle data processing, while IoT applications leverage embedded modules. Use cases such as real-time analytics in financial services, high-frequency trading platforms, and 5G infrastructure are exemplifying shifting consumption patterns toward ultra-fast, reliable storage solutions. Future Outlook (5–10 Years): Innovation & Strategic Growth Key innovation pipelines include the development of PCIe 6.0-compatible NVMe drives, integration of AI-based predictive maintenance, and advancements in 3D NAND stacking. Disruptive technologies like storage-class memory (SCM) and persistent memory are poised to complement NVMe solutions, offering ultra-low latency and byte-addressability.
